jQuery의 :not() 선택기는 CSS3 호환이라고 주장하지만 기능 면에서 상당한 차이를 보입니다. CSS3에 정의된 :not() 의사 클래스와 비교합니다.
차이점 구문 및 기능:
결과:
CSS에서 직접 jQuery :not() 선택기를 사용하려고 하면 다음으로 인해 의도한 대로 작동하지 않을 수 있습니다. 구문 및 기능 차이. 질문에 제공된 예는 이 문제를 보여줍니다.
CSS3 해결 방법:
이러한 제한을 우회하기 위해 CSS3는 다음 해결 방법을 제공합니다.
참고:
CSS3은 결국 Selectors 4에 정의된 향상된 :not() 선택기를 지원하게 되어 더 광범위한 기능을 허용합니다. 그러나 이는 여전히 미래의 표준이며 널리 구현되지는 않습니다.
위 내용은 jQuery의 `:not()` 선택기가 CSS의 `:not()`처럼 동작하지 않는 이유는 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!